Bitcoin Market Analysis: Navigating Today’s Volatile Landscape

Analyzing Bitcoin’s⁢ price movements requires a keen understanding⁤ of its‌ historical data. ⁣Since its inception in 2009, Bitcoin ⁢has experienced significant volatility, characterized ​by ‌abrupt price surges⁢ followed by sharp declines. Over⁣ the years, several key trends⁣ have emerged, driven by various factors including market sentiment, technological advancements, and regulatory developments. ⁣Major milestones in Bitcoin’s history,such ​as ⁣the 2013 price surge ‌ that⁤ saw⁢ Bitcoin​ reach⁣ $1,000,and its 2017 rally,where it peaked⁤ near $20,000,serve as benchmarks for understanding its current price dynamics. Each of‌ these pivotal moments ​was​ followed by corrections that highlighted⁢ market psychology and investor‍ behavior, providing critical insights into future ‌movements.

analyzing Market Sentiment: The ‌Role of News ⁣and Social Media

The influence of news and social media on market‍ sentiment cannot be overstated, particularly in the volatile world of cryptocurrency.‌ Market movements are often driven by how investors ⁣interpret news events ​and⁢ discussions happening across various platforms. Key factors⁣ include:

  • Breaking news: Real-time‌ updates about⁢ regulatory changes,⁢ institutional investments, or ​technological​ advancements can trigger immediate market‌ reactions.
  • Social Media‍ Trends: ‍Platforms‌ like Twitter and Reddit serve as ⁤arenas⁣ for discussion, with viral posts capable of​ swaying public opinion rapidly.
  • Sentiment ⁣Analysis Tools: ⁢Many traders utilize algorithms to analyze social media​ posts and news articles to gauge prevailing market ⁤moods.

Furthermore, the nature of the content disseminated plays⁢ a critical role in ⁢shaping sentiment. Positive⁤ news can ​bolster ⁢confidence, ⁢leading to upward price movements, while negative stories can induce fear and⁢ result in sell-offs. The interconnectedness of⁣ media ⁣narratives‍ and⁢ psychological triggers means that understanding sentiment ​is‍ essential for anticipating market‍ behavior. Noteworthy⁢ elements influencing sentiment include:

  • Influencer opinions: Statements ‌from prominent figures in the crypto ​sphere ‍can carry significant weight, influencing⁢ market ⁢participants’ beliefs ‌and actions.
  • Market Sentiment Indexes: ‍ These metrics compile data from various sources to provide a quantitative view of market emotions, aiding investors in ​their decision-making.

technical Analysis ‌Tools:⁢ Utilizing ⁣charts and Indicators for Decision-Making

In ‌the realm ‍of financial trading,‌ technical analysis serves as⁢ a crucial ⁣framework ‌for decision-making, utilizing a variety⁤ of charts‌ and indicators that allow traders to ‍assess market trends and predict future price movements. One of the primary tools in this ​analysis is ⁣the price chart, which visually represents ‌the ‍historical price ​movements⁢ of an ​asset. By examining⁢ different chart types—such as line charts,bar charts,and candlestick charts—traders can discern ‌patterns and‍ identify ‍potential turning points ‌in the market. ‍Additionally, indicators like moving⁢ averages, Relative Strength⁤ Index‍ (RSI), and ⁣Bollinger Bands‍ provide ‌quantifiable data that help ⁢traders⁢ gauge momentum and⁢ volatility, enhancing their​ analytic ‌capabilities.

Moreover, the integration of these visual ‌tools encourages a ⁤more systematic approach⁤ to trading ​strategies. Traders often use ​ support and resistance levels ⁤to pinpoint entry and exit ⁣points, allowing for more calculated risk ⁤management.⁣ Coupled with indicators that signal overbought‍ or oversold conditions, ​traders can make ‌informed decisions that ⁢align with market sentiment. The synergy ⁢between​ charts ⁢and indicators not only aids in confirming trends⁣ but also in identifying divergences that may indicate potential⁤ reversals, thereby ‍refining the accuracy‌ of predictions‍ in an increasingly ⁤complex financial landscape.

Strategic approaches:⁣ Risk Management and⁣ Investment Diversification in Crypto

In ‍the dynamic ⁣landscape of cryptocurrencies, effective risk ⁢management⁣ is essential for safeguarding investments. Investors‌ should ‌consider implementing stop-loss orders ‌ to automatically sell assets ​when prices drop to a predetermined level, thereby limiting⁢ potential losses. Additionally, ⁣maintaining a well-defined investment⁢ strategy tailored to individual risk‌ tolerance‍ is crucial.Techniques such ⁣as position sizing can help minimize exposure ​to any single asset. It is also ​vital to‍ be aware of market volatility,‍ which can substantially affect asset‍ prices; therefore,​ staying⁢ informed about⁢ market‌ trends and‍ news can contribute to ‍more calculated decision-making.

Diversification is​ another key‌ approach⁢ in navigating‌ the crypto market. By spreading investments ⁣across multiple cryptocurrencies and ‌associated projects, investors can‌ mitigate the inherent risks‌ of this‌ volatile sector. Strategies for diversification may include​ investing in ‍various asset classes, such as‌ DeFi tokens, ⁢stablecoins, and ‌non-fungible tokens (NFTs), ⁤to⁣ create a balanced portfolio. Moreover, emerging‌ technologies or​ sectors​ with ⁢strong growth potential can provide​ additional opportunities. Investors should also regularly reassess their portfolios and adjust their ⁢allocations ⁢based on performance metrics and ⁤market conditions‌ to ensure they remain aligned with their financial goals.
